burning in summit county - completely contained. the frey gulch fire started around noon sunday just above the shooting range at the summit county landfill.. that's near keystone... so far - it's burned 22 acres and is 30 percent contained. people in the area will probably continue to see smoke for the next few days. october is fire safety month.. and this week...is fire prevention week.. this year - the focus is on smoke alarms... the national fire protection association says - homes with working alarms - are 51 percent less likely - to have fatal fires. they say - make sure to check the date on your alarms - test them every year... and replace them every 10 years. paxton lynch is going to have togl forget about sunday... and move on from his first nfl career loss. he was sacked six times... and stripped of the ball twice. he threw a pick but it was interceppted. denver made it the end zone once...

mo galaxy note sevens... they've temporarily halted production of the phone -after multiple replacement devices caught fire.. last month - the tech giant had to recall about 2 and a half million of the original phones...after reports of extreme overheating...and even some explosions. it's been called "battery gate"...as samsung faces a damaged reputation and low sales.. on sunday - they released ast customers who are worried about their replacements...can exchange it for a different samsung

died from his injuries several weeks later. yesterday his name was read - along with more than 100 other fallen firefighters - at a ceremony held by the national fallen firefighters foundation. whelan served denver fire for 15 years. he left behind a son and wife. the winner of the nobel peace prize says he'll donate his winnings to victims of his country's conflict. colombian president juan manuel santos says he'll be giving away 925-thousand dollar santos made the announcement yesterday during a visit with his family and top officials to a town in western colombia hard hit by the half-century conflict. santos was awarded the nobel peace prize on friday. the nobel peace prize will be awarded on december tenth in
